Larry King may have left his post at CNN but that doesn't mean he's stopped interviewing celebrities. He kicks off his second season of Larry King Now today, July 15, which can be viewed on Ora TV and Hulu. The first guest is Jane Lynch, which seems especially prescient with this weekend's unexpected and unsettling news about Glee star Cory Monteith's death.

In these clips, which were obviously recorded before Cory Monteith's passing, Larry King asked Jane Lynch about the closeness of the Glee cast and Monteith's recent return to rehab. "He had to renew his vows to sobriety," she says.

In another clip, Larry talks to Jane about the news of her divorce. "It's about two people who decided it's better to go apart than stay together," Lynch says, her head in her hands and eyes closed.

"Friends?" King prods.

"Yeah, all's good. We have a little girl, she has a little girl," she says, correcting herself mid-sentence, "who's very dear to me...She's doing great."
